  4. Infection Control- Fact sheet 2004 numbers Revenues 3,524 MSEKEBITA margin 15.2 %

  5. Extended Care – Fact sheet 2004 Numbers Revenues 2,701 MSEKEBITA margin 18.9 %

  6. Medical Systems – Fact sheet 2004 Numbers Revenues 4,620 MSEKEBITA margin 15.4 %

  24. Strategy for Growth The Getinge group will reach its growth targets by: • Development of existing positions • Organic growth • Bolt-on acquisitions • Acquisitions of new globally leading product lines that will strengthen our position as an innovative provider of solutions

  25. Strategy for growth 2004 – 2007 Infection Control Principally organic growth supplemented by bolt-on acquisitions to reach new geographical territories, add new technologies in existing product lines • Strengthen solution provider capabilities • Focused approach towards the global Life Science industry • Geographical expansion • Continue to strengthen competitiveness through improved production structure and logistics

  26. Strategy for growth 2004 – 2007 Extended Care Principally organic growth on existing markets supplemented by bolt-on acquisitions to add new technologies in existing product lines • Total bed-side management in elderly care • Enter the hospital market / bariatric care • Improved supply chain for increased competitiveness

  27. Strategy for growth 2004 – 2007 Medical Systems Organic growth on existing markets and existing product lines Acquisitions of new globally leading product lines that will strengthen our position as an innovative solution provider with special emphasis on critical care and cardiac surgery • Position as provider of integrated solutions • Strengthen sales network in developing economies and North America • Continue to strengthen product leadership position • Develop Critical Care product portfolio through acquisitions
